Плата за прогресс в области технологий часто включает в себя возникновение ошибок и неполадок. Одной из таких проблем, с которой могут столкнуться пользователи операционной системы Windows, является ошибка «The native api dll was not found c windows system32 winhvplatform dll». Эта ошибка может возникнуть при запуске программы или игры, требующей наличие указанного DLL файла.
Основная причина возникновения данной ошибки заключается в том, что файл winhvplatform.dll отсутствует или поврежден. Этот файл является частью Windows API и необходим для работы некоторых программ и игр.
Решить проблему «The native api dll was not found c windows system32 winhvplatform dll» можно несколькими способами. Во-первых, можно попытаться восстановить отсутствующий файл путем его загрузки из интернета или с другого компьютера с такой же операционной системой. Во-вторых, можно попробовать переустановить программу или игру, вызывающую ошибку. В-третьих, можно воспользоваться системными утилитами для восстановления поврежденных файлов операционной системы.
Важно помнить: при использовании файлов из интернета всегда следует быть осторожным, так как скачивание непроверенных файлов может привести к инфицированию компьютера вредоносными программами. Рекомендуется скачивать файлы только с официальных источников или использовать антивирусное программное обеспечение для проверки файлов на наличие вирусов.
Если указанные способы не привели к решению проблемы, рекомендуется обратиться за помощью к специалистам или на форумы сообщества пользователей Windows. Они могут предложить альтернативные способы решения данной проблемы, основанные на их собственном опыте. Кроме того, специалисты могут оценить состояние вашей операционной системы и дать рекомендации по ее оптимизации, что также может устранить ошибку «The native api dll was not found c windows system32 winhvplatform dll».
Как исправить ошибку «The native api dll was not found c windows system32 winhvplatform dll» в Windows?
Ошибка «The native api dll was not found c windows system32 winhvplatform dll» может возникать при запуске некоторых приложений в операционной системе Windows. Эта ошибка указывает на то, что необходимая библиотека winhvplatform.dll не была найдена в системной папке c:\windows\system32. Возникновение этой ошибки может быть связано с различными причинами, такими как повреждение файла, отсутствие обновлений операционной системы или конфликты с установленными программами.
Вот некоторые методы, которые можно использовать для исправления ошибки «The native api dll was not found c windows system32 winhvplatform dll» в Windows:
- Перезапустите компьютер. Иногда ошибка может возникнуть из-за временных проблем в системе и перезагрузка компьютера может помочь.
- Обновите операционную систему до последней версии. Возможно, Microsoft уже выпустила исправления для этой ошибки, и обновление операционной системы может решить проблему. Для обновления операционной системы откройте меню «Пуск», найдите и выберите «Настройки», затем щелкните «Обновление и безопасность» и выберите «Windows Update». Нажмите «Проверить наличие обновлений» и установите все доступные обновления.
- Проверьте систему на вредоносное ПО. Вредоносное ПО может повредить или удалить системные файлы, включая winhvplatform.dll. Установите антивирусное программное обеспечение на компьютер и выполните полное сканирование системы, чтобы выявить и удалить вредоносные программы.
- Восстановите файл winhvplatform.dll из резервной копии. Если у вас есть резервная копия файла winhvplatform.dll, можно попытаться восстановить его. Откройте папку c:\windows\system32 и найдите файл winhvplatform.dll. Правой кнопкой мыши щелкните файл и выберите «Восстановить предыдущую версию», затем следуйте инструкциям на экране для восстановления файла из резервной копии.
- Переустановите программу, вызывающую ошибку. Если ошибка возникает при запуске конкретного приложения, попробуйте переустановить это приложение. Удалите приложение, перезагрузите компьютер и затем установите его снова.
- Свяжитесь с технической поддержкой разработчика программы. Если вы не можете найти решение самостоятельно, свяжитесь с технической поддержкой разработчика программы, вызывающей ошибку. Они могут предоставить дополнительную информацию и помочь вам решить проблему.
Надеемся, что один из этих методов поможет вам исправить ошибку «The native api dll was not found c windows system32 winhvplatform dll» в Windows. Если проблема остается, рекомендуется обратиться за помощью к опытному специалисту или в службу поддержки Microsoft.
Проверьте наличие файла winhvplatform.dll в системной папке
Если вы столкнулись с ошибкой «The native api dll was not found c windows system32 winhvplatform dll», вы можете решить проблему, проверив наличие файла winhvplatform.dll в системной папке вашей операционной системы.
Файл winhvplatform.dll является частью операционной системы Windows и необходим для работы с компонентами виртуализации. Если этот файл отсутствует или поврежден, могут возникнуть ошибки при запуске программ или при использовании виртуальных машин.
Чтобы проверить наличие файла winhvplatform.dll в системной папке, выполните следующие шаги:
- Откройте проводник Windows и перейдите в папку C:\Windows\System32.
- Прокрутите список файлов и найдите файл с названием winhvplatform.dll.
- Если файл присутствует, это означает, что проблема, скорее всего, не связана с отсутствием этого файла. В этом случае, возможно, вам понадобится выполнить другие действия для решения проблемы.
- Если файл отсутствует, это может быть причиной возникновения ошибки. Но не паникуйте, есть несколько возможных решений.
Выберите одно из следующих действий для восстановления файла winhvplatform.dll:
- Скопируйте файл winhvplatform.dll из другого компьютера, где он присутствует и работает нормально. Поместите его в папку C:\Windows\System32 на вашем компьютере.
- Используйте программу проверки целостности системных файлов, такую как SFC (System File Checker). Она может автоматически восстановить отсутствующие или поврежденные файлы системы. Для запуска SFC выполните следующие действия:
- Откройте командную строку с правами администратора. Нажмите Win + X и выберите «Командная строка (администратор)» из списка.
- В командной строке введите команду «sfc /scannow» (без кавычек) и нажмите Enter.
- Дождитесь завершения процесса сканирования и восстановления файлов. Это может занять некоторое время. После завершения перезагрузите компьютер.
- Переустановите операционную систему Windows. Это решение является крайней мерой и должно быть выполнено лишь в случае, если предыдущие методы не помогли восстановить файл winhvplatform.dll.
Если после выполнения этих действий проблема не решена, рекомендуется обратиться за помощью к специалистам-технической поддержке или форумам пользователей Windows.
Запомните, что изменение системных файлов может привести к непредсказуемым последствиям и потому всегда рекомендуется создавать резервные копии и быть осторожным при вмешательстве в системные файлы операционной системы.
Восстановите отсутствующий файл winhvplatform.dll
Проблема: Вы получаете сообщение «The native api dll was not found c windows system32 winhvplatform dll» при попытке запустить некоторые приложения или игры на компьютере под управлением операционной системы Windows.
Причина: Ошибка указывает на отсутствие файла winhvplatform.dll, который требуется для выполнения нужных функций приложения. Возможно, файл был удален, поврежден или перемещен в другое место.
Решение: Чтобы восстановить отсутствующий файл winhvplatform.dll, вы можете выполнить следующие действия:
- Поиск файла в системе: Проверьте, есть ли файл winhvplatform.dll в других папках на вашем компьютере, кроме C:\Windows\System32. Используйте функцию поиска файлов в проводнике для выполнения этой задачи.
- Восстановление файла из корзины: Если вы случайно удалили файл winhvplatform.dll и он все еще находится в Корзине, восстановите его из Корзины. Просто щелкните правой кнопкой мыши на файле в Корзине и выберите «Восстановить».
- Использование системного восстановления: Вы можете восстановить отсутствующий файл winhvplatform.dll, используя функцию системного восстановления Windows. Это позволит вернуть вашу систему к более ранней точке во времени, когда файл был доступен. Откройте «Панель управления», выберите «Система и безопасность», затем «Система» и нажмите «Восстановление системы». Следуйте инструкциям мастера восстановления, чтобы выбрать нужную точку восстановления и восстановить систему.
- Скачивание файла из Интернета: Если два предыдущих метода не помогли, вы можете попытаться найти и скачать файл winhvplatform.dll из надежного источника в Интернете. Убедитесь, что вы выбираете надежный источник, чтобы избежать скачивания вредоносного файла.
После того, как вы восстановите отсутствующий файл winhvplatform.dll, перезагрузите компьютер и проверьте, устранилась ли проблема и по-прежнему ли вы получаете сообщение об ошибке «The native api dll was not found c windows system32 winhvplatform dll». Если проблема остается, попробуйте выполнить другие решения или обратитесь за поддержкой к производителю приложения или операционной системы Windows.
Обновите Windows и драйверы
Одной из причин возникновения ошибки «The native api dll was not found c windows system32 winhvplatform dll» может быть устаревшая версия операционной системы Windows или неправильно установленные драйверы. Чтобы решить эту проблему, рекомендуется обновить Windows и драйверы на вашем компьютере.
Следуйте этим шагам, чтобы обновить Windows:
- Откройте меню «Пуск» и выберите «Настройки».
- В меню «Настройки» выберите «Обновление и безопасность».
- В разделе «Обновление и безопасность» выберите «Проверить наличие обновлений».
- Дождитесь, пока операционная система выполнит поиск доступных обновлений.
- Если обновления найдены, нажмите на кнопку «Установить обновления».
- Дождитесь завершения установки обновлений и перезагрузите компьютер, если это необходимо.
Как только Windows будет обновлена, можно перейти к обновлению драйверов. Воспользуйтесь следующими шагами, чтобы обновить драйверы:
- Откройте меню «Пуск» и выберите «Диспетчер устройств».
- В окне «Диспетчер устройств» найдите категорию, соответствующую проблемному устройству (например, «Процессоры» или «Видеоадаптеры»).
- Щелкните правой кнопкой мыши на устройстве, вызывающем ошибку, и выберите «Обновить драйвер».
- Выберите опцию «Автоматический поиск обновленного программного обеспечения драйвера».
- Дождитесь, пока операционная система найдет и установит обновленный драйвер для выбранного устройства.
- После завершения процесса обновления драйвера перезагрузите компьютер, если это необходимо.
Обновление Windows и драйверов может помочь устранить ошибку «The native api dll was not found c windows system32 winhvplatform dll» и повысить стабильность и производительность вашей системы. Если проблема все еще возникает после обновления, рекомендуется обратиться к специалистам для дальнейшего решения.